How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Transit Village?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Transit Village Studio Apartments | $1,881 | $1,300 | $2,840 |
| Transit Village 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,277 | $900 | $4,354 |
| Transit Village 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,531 | $850 | $5,218 |
| Transit Village 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,145 | $835 | $6,975 |
| Transit Village 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,204 | $1,570 | $6,975 |
| Transit Village 5 Bedroom Apartments | $4,037 | $1,100 | $6,975 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Transit Village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Transit Village?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Transit Village with Washer/Dryer is at 2623 Sherwood Cir, Unit 2623 Sherwood listed at $1,100.
How much is the average rent for Transit Village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Transit Village with Washer/Dryer is $2,901.
What is the largest Transit Village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Transit Village is a 3,500 square feet unit starting from $1,100 at 2623 Sherwood Cir, Unit 2623 Sherwood.
What is the average size for Transit Village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Transit Village is currently at 809 sq ft.
